M ajor League Baseball's trade deadline is scheduled for next Thursday, which means teams have less than a week to get their midsummer shopping done. The moves have already started, as the Mariners recently acquired Josh Naylor from the Diamondbacks while the Yankees acquired Ryan McMahon in a trade with the Rockies .

With their infield depleted by injuries, the Rays turned to a familiar face to upgrade their depth on Saturday. Tampa Bay acquired infielder Tristan Gray from the White Sox for cash considerations and added him to the active roster in Cincinnati.
The trade deadline season is just above the horizon, and the stove is starting to heat up as the Rays issued a trade to the Kansas City Royals. The Tampa Bay Rays have sent right-handed pitcher Joey Krehbiel to the Royals in exchange for cash considerations.
